SEMI Q3 2025 Silicon Wafers: 3% YoY Growth, 300mm AI Logic Cloud Memory, 3,313 MSI Shipments

Worldwide silicon wafer shipments increased 3.1% year-on-year to 3,313 million square inches (MSI) in Q3 2025 from 3,214 MSI in Q3 2024. Shipments decreased 0.4% quarter-over-quarter from 3,327 MSI in Q2 2025, with softness in recovery for epitaxial wafer slices.

Lee Chungwei, Chairman of SEMI SMG and Vice President and Chief Auditor at GlobalWafers, stated that January through September silicon shipments registered a year-on-year increase driven by 300 mm shipments for advanced logic, cloud infrastructure, and memory demand. AI contributes to wafer demand growth through investments in advanced processes.

Silicon wafers are the substrate material for most semiconductors, produced in diameters up to 300 mm.

The SEMI Silicon Manufacturers Group (SMG) is a sub-committee of the SEMI Electronic Materials Group (EMG), open to SEMI members manufacturing polycrystalline silicon, monocrystalline silicon, or silicon wafers (cut, polished, epitaxial). The SMG develops statistics for the silicon industry.
